A family of four is celebrating a birthday on their yacht in the Caribbean when a catastrophic "polarity reversal" occurs. They wake up the next morning to find the ocean has completely vanished, leaving their boat stranded in a vast, craggy desert. To reach safety, they must trek across the former seafloor while being hunted by both a mysterious human psychopath and swarms of aggressive, man-eating deep-sea crabs. The 2024 film (originally titled Survivre ), directed by Frédéric Jardin, is a high-concept French disaster thriller that blends ecological catastrophe with "creature feature" horror. Released digitally in late 2024 and early 2025, the film gained attention for its unique premise: a sudden shift in the Earth's magnetic poles causes the oceans to abruptly drain, leaving a family stranded in a vast, desolate desert that was once the sea floor.
